Darwin Cemetery is located on Highway 3 just across the Pushmataha county line in Darwin, Oklahoma. This cemetery has been around even longer than when Oklahoma became a state 100 years ago.

One of the cornerstones on the community building located at the Darwin cemetery reads established in 1906 and the community building was built in August 1970.

I remember as a boy going to the other building on Memorial Day. The community would get together and have a pot luck meal while we would clean off the grave areas.

Here is a memory submitted by Patsy Roberta (Martin) Dobbs that explains in detail what went on at the cemetery:

The Community Building at Darwin Cemetery, which began as a church, is where Decoration Day is still held each year on the Third Sunday in May.  There has been an observance on that day as far back as I can remember.  Saturdays brought families to the cemetery to work clearing out brush and tall grasses and cleaning and decorating the graves and family plots.

On Sunday, everyone came from near and far for church, then dinner-on-the-ground (actually on church benches put together facing each other with each family laying down their best tablecloth before putting down big platters of fried chicken, bowls of all kind of fresh and cooked vegetables, potato salads, and beans of all kinds).  Also on each family's cloth were fabulous deserts; one egg cakes, two egg cakes, white cakes with 7-minute boiled frosting, chocolate cakes, tall coconut cakes, fried pies with fruit fillings, coconut cream pies, banana pudding, banana cream pies, chocolate pies, custard pies, and rice pudding with raisins!  There was tea and lemonade, milk and buttermilk, and sometimes a tub full of ice would chill a Coca Cola, Royal Crown Soda, Mission Orange, or Grapette, etc.  It just overwhelmed the senses! 

After a blessing we filled plates and began the earnest business of eating and visiting, gossiping, exchanging news with people we saw frequently, with people from far away who had living relatives nearby, and with those who had traveled hundreds of miles knowing that "Third Sunday in May" would be in full swing, honoring both the living and those gone on before. 

Everyone ate until they needed a good nap after which the ladies repacked left-over foodstuff back into boxes or No. 2 washtubs for the trip back home.  It was then time for the afternoon program to begin

After the movers-and-shakers and everyone else (usually females and assorted children as most of the men stayed outside talking, chewing tobacco, smoking, and no telling what-all) went back into the meeting building.  After a short business meeting to elect officers for the Darwin Cemetery Committee which went off as smoothly as Oklahoma politics often does; that is, either the fix is in, or not.  Those elected were often put forth by various interested parties who could count votes as well as any campaign manager in a presidential election.  This was following by singing the rest of the afternoon.  We sang all the old favorites from old shaped-note songbooks.  How beautiful to hear! 

As the afternoon waned one after the other family would call up their dogs, round up the kids, load up the cars, pickups, trucks, mule driven wagons, or the occasional riding horse and head back home.  Cows needed milked, chickens fed, eggs gathered, and various farm chores waited to be completed.  Leftovers were put out for dinner and the wood stoves were not lit unless someone just HAD to have cornbread or biscuits

Pat Dobbs, May 17. 2008, California - Thanks, Pat!

We would like to hear from you about this cemetery project. There was not much information about the Darwin Cemetery listed on the Internet. A couple have it listed in Atoka County. Although there are some Atoka County past residents buried here, the cemetery is located about a quarter mile east of the county line in Pushmataha County.
